Webb20 dec. 2024 · Open the lid and set the temperature dial to “Smoke.”. The smoke setting temperature range is 180-210° F/ 80-100° C. Press the start button on the pellet grill, and you will hear the fan running. If your Pit Boss grill has a Prime button, hold the “Prime” button until you hear the pellets drop into the firepot. lewp leaks forum

Despite the popularity of smoke tubes, most people have no clue how to use a smoke tube in a Pit Boss pellet … WebbIf Pit boss grill Temperature starts flashing at SMOKE mode, this indicates the temperature is dropped below the 110°F. If Grill Temperature begins flashing at COOK mode, it means the temperature is less than 150°F. In both cases, flashing temperature indicates, there is a risk of flame going out.

It works great … lew phonePit Boss temperature problems typically arise because the burn pot isn’t getting enough oxygen to achieve or maintain the desired temps. Check the burn pot, the air intake, and the fan to make sure there are no obstructions. If the burn pot has holes or severe corrosion, it needs to be replaced.
